/* {{{ proto resource crack_opendict(string dictionary)
   Opens a new cracklib dictionary */
ZEND_FUNCTION(crack_opendict)
{
	zval **dictpath;
	long resource;

	if (ZEND_NUM_ARGS() != 1 || zend_get_parameters_ex(1, &dictpath) == FAILURE) {
		WRONG_PARAM_COUNT;
	}

	convert_to_string_ex(dictpath);

	if (-1 == (resource = _crack_open_dict(Z_STRVAL_PP(dictpath) TSRMLS_CC))) {
		RETURN_FALSE;
	}

	RETURN_RESOURCE(resource);
}
/* }}} */

/* {{{ proto bool crack_closedict([resource dictionary])
   Closes an open cracklib dictionary */
ZEND_FUNCTION(crack_closedict)
{
	PWDICT *pwdict;
	zval **dictionary;
	long id;

	switch (ZEND_NUM_ARGS()) {
		case 0:
			id = CRACKG(current_id);
			break;
		case 1:
			if (zend_get_parameters_ex(1, &dictionary) == FAILURE) {
				WRONG_PARAM_COUNT;
			}
			id = Z_LVAL_PP(dictionary);
			break;
		default:
			WRONG_PARAM_COUNT;
			break;
	}

	if (id < 1) {
		RETURN_FALSE;
	}

	ZEND_FETCH_RESOURCE(pwdict, PWDICT *, dictionary, id, "cracklib dictionary", le_crack);
	if (CRACKG(current_id) == id) {
		CRACKG(current_id) = -1;
	}
	zend_list_delete(id);

	RETURN_TRUE;
}
/* }}} */

/* {{{ proto bool crack_check([resource dictionary,] string password)
   Performs an obscure check with the given password */
ZEND_FUNCTION(crack_check)
{
	zval **dictionary = NULL, **password;
	char pwtrunced[STRINGSIZE];
	char *message;
	PWDICT *pwdict;
	long id;

	switch (ZEND_NUM_ARGS()) {
		case 1:
			if (zend_get_parameters_ex(1, &password) == FAILURE) {
				RETURN_FALSE;
			}
			if (NULL != CRACKG(default_dictionary) && CRACKG(current_id) == -1) {
				_crack_open_dict(CRACKG(default_dictionary) TSRMLS_CC);
			}
			id = CRACKG(current_id);
			break;
		case 2:
			if (zend_get_parameters_ex(2, &dictionary, &password) == FAILURE) {
				RETURN_FALSE;
			}
			id = Z_LVAL_PP(dictionary);
			break;
		default:
			WRONG_PARAM_COUNT;
		break;
	}

	ZEND_FETCH_RESOURCE(pwdict, PWDICT *, dictionary, id, "cracklib dictionary", le_crack);
	convert_to_string_ex(password);

	/* Prevent buffer overflow attacks. */
	strlcpy(pwtrunced, Z_STRVAL_PP(password), sizeof(pwtrunced));

	message = (char *)FascistLook(pwdict, pwtrunced);

	if (NULL != CRACKG(last_message)) {
		efree(CRACKG(last_message));
	}

	if (NULL == message) {
		CRACKG(last_message) = estrdup("strong password");
		RETURN_TRUE;
	}
	
	CRACKG(last_message) = estrdup(message);
	RETURN_FALSE;
}
/* }}} */

/* {{{ proto string crack_getlastmessage(void)
   Returns the message from the last obscure check */
ZEND_FUNCTION(crack_getlastmessage)
{
	if (ZEND_NUM_ARGS() != 0) {
		WRONG_PARAM_COUNT;
	}
	
	if (NULL == CRACKG(last_message)) {
		php_error_docref(NULL TSRMLS_CC, E_WARNING, "No obscure checks in this session");
		RETURN_FALSE;
	}

	RETURN_STRING(CRACKG(last_message), 1);
}
/* }}} */
